WebFinding a number sequence formula is one of the easiest ways to solve such patterns. It is : d = a (n) - a (n - 1) Here a (n) is the last term in the given sequence and a (n-1) is the previous term of the sequence. So basically the amount between each of the numbers in an arithmetic sequence is a common difference. WebMathematics in the Modern World Lesson 1: Mathematics in Our World Assessment I.
